WebBipolar disorder is a recurrent illness, meaning that it can occur throughout one’s lifetime. So the best treatment is usually long-term and involves acute management (to manage current symptoms), continuation therapy (to prevent return of symptoms from the same episode) and maintenance (to prevent a recurrence of symptoms in the future). WebDec 16, 2024 · Affective disorders, also known as mood disorders, are mental disorders that primarily affect a person’s emotional state. They impact the way they think, feel, and go about daily life. There are many types of mood disorders, including major depressive disorder and bipolar disorder, among others. Schizoaffective disorder is a chronic mental health condition characterized primarily by symptoms of schizophrenia, such as hallucinations or delusions, and symptoms of a mood disorder, such as mania and depression.
